A strategic importance

In the 17th century, despite an outdated defense system, the Haut-Kœnigsbourg castle regained its strategic importance. It controlled one of the main access routes to Alsace, while the region was a major stake in the Thirty Years' War (1618-1648). The Catholic German principalities, supported by the Duke of Lorraine fought against the Protestant principalities, supported by the King of France and the King of Sweden. For the inhabitants of the nearby villages, the castle was a safe refuge from the looters of the different camps.
